The Global Neuro-Oncological Diseases Device Market was valued at USD 4.3 billion in 2023 and is projected to reach USD 8.1 billion by 2031, growing at a CAGR of 8.1% from 2023 to 2031. The market's growth is propelled by increasing incidences of brain tumors and other neurological cancers, coupled with rapid advancements in diagnostic and therapeutic devices. Heightened awareness of neuro-oncology and rising healthcare expenditures are also contributing to the demand for advanced devices in the diagnosis, treatment, and monitoring of neuro-oncological conditions.
Drivers:
1. Rising Incidence of Neurological
Cancers:
The global prevalence of brain and central
nervous system cancers is rising, creating urgent demand for more effective
diagnostic and therapeutic devices. Increased access to MRI, PET scans, and
biopsy-guided systems has accelerated early detection and treatment planning.
2. Technological Advancements in Imaging
and Surgical Devices:
Innovation in minimally invasive
neurosurgical tools, robotic-assisted surgery, and AI-integrated imaging
systems are revolutionizing treatment precision, reducing recovery time, and
improving patient outcomes.
3. Expanding Healthcare Infrastructure in
Emerging Markets:
Developing countries are significantly
increasing investments in specialized oncology units, boosting the availability
and affordability of neuro-oncological devices.
Restraints:
1. High Cost of Devices and Procedures:
The high cost associated with
neuro-oncological surgeries, imaging technologies, and implantable devices
limits access, particularly in low-income regions.
2. Complexity of Treatment and Diagnosis:
The intricate nature of neurological tumors
and the delicate structure of the brain pose significant challenges to accurate
diagnosis and safe treatment, potentially restricting the market’s expansion.
Opportunity:
1. Integration of AI and Big Data in
Neuro-Oncology:
AI-driven diagnostic algorithms and
predictive analytics are creating new pathways for personalized treatment and
early detection, offering substantial opportunities for innovation.
2. Growth in Telemedicine and Remote
Diagnostics:
The growing demand for remote patient
management and diagnostic services in neuro-oncology provides a fertile ground
for the development of portable and digital health devices.
Market
by System Type Insights:
In 2023, the Imaging Devices segment held
the dominant share of the market, driven by increased demand for high-precision
diagnostic equipment such as MRI, CT, and PET scanners. These tools are vital
in tumor localization, grading, and treatment planning. Meanwhile, the Surgical
Devices segment is anticipated to witness the fastest growth due to the rising
adoption of neuronavigation and stereotactic systems in neurosurgical
procedures.
Market
by End-use Insights:
Hospitals accounted for the largest share
in 2023, supported by extensive infrastructure for advanced neuro-oncological
treatment. The Research & Academic Institutes segment is growing rapidly
due to increased clinical studies and technological trials for innovative
neuro-oncology solutions. Ambulatory surgical centers are also gaining traction
for outpatient neuro-diagnostic procedures.
Market
by Regional Insights:
North America led the global
neuro-oncological diseases device market in 2023, owing to its sophisticated
healthcare infrastructure, robust R&D investment, and favorable
reimbursement policies. Europe followed closely, supported by increasing brain
tumor incidences and public healthcare initiatives. Asia-Pacific is expected to
register the highest growth rate, with China, India, and Japan showing strong
demand for affordable and efficient neuro-diagnostic and treatment devices.
Competitive
Scenario:
Key players in the market include Medtronic
plc, GE Healthcare, Siemens Healthineers, Elekta AB, Varian Medical Systems,
Accuray Incorporated, Philips Healthcare, Brainlab AG, Monteris Medical, and
NeuroLogica Corporation. Companies are focused on product innovation, AI
integration, strategic partnerships, and global expansion to gain a competitive
edge. Notable developments include:
2023: Siemens Healthineers introduced an
AI-powered MRI platform for enhanced neuroimaging accuracy.
2024: Brainlab AG launched a
next-generation neuronavigation system with augmented reality (AR) integration.
2025: Medtronic plc acquired a
neuro-oncology diagnostics firm to strengthen its product portfolio and market
reach.
